Abstract
We propose an engineering model for determination of minimum detectable microwave power (MDMP) of a spin-torque microwave detector (STMD) connected to a standard 50-Ohm load. We obtain that the MDMP of a STMD can reach 10 nW at room temperature. The developed formalism can be used for the optimization of the practical parameters of various systems based on a STMD.
